Situated in Contra Costa County, Rodeo is an unincorporated community in California that provides a quiet, residential lifestyle within the San Francisco Bay Area. With a population of approximately 8,600, it maintains a small-town character while being strategically located for commuters and travelers. The area is characterized by its proximity to the San Pablo Bay and its straightforward access to Interstate 80, making it a convenient gateway between the inner Bay and Northern California's scenic regions. It is an ideal spot for those looking to experience the local side of the East Bay away from the typical tourist paths.

Before you go: Rodeo essentials

  • Limited tourist-oriented infrastructure compared to neighboring cities like Berkeley or Richmond.

  • Primarily a residential area with a small-town feel.

  • Located near major refineries, which is a notable aspect of the local industrial landscape.

Getting Around

A car is highly recommended for navigating Rodeo and visiting nearby attractions in the East Bay.

Local Pace

Expect a quiet environment with limited nightlife; most activity centers around local residential life.

Best time to visit Rodeo

April-June, September-October

Best Season

Spring

Mild weather and greening hills make this a pleasant time for regional hiking.

Best Season

Summer

Warm and dry weather is typical; coastal breezes from the bay provide some cooling.

Best Season

Fall

Often the best weather of the year, with clear skies and warm temperatures through October.

Winter

The rainy season in Northern California; temperatures are cool but rarely freezing.
